E118: Diana Contreras
Diana Contreras was abducted from the Valley Plaza mall while Christmas shopping in 1993. Her body was found in Taft the next day. This is that story.

Encore: The Bobby Sox Killer
For 72 years residents have flocked to the Kern County Fairgrounds on South P Street for fun and amusement. What many people don't realize, three years before the fair moved here, this location was the site of one of Bakersfield's most horrific murders.
